Sec. 370.164. DECLARATION OF TAKING.
(a)An authority may file a declaration of taking with the clerk of the court:
(1)in which the authority files a condemnation petition under Chapter 21 , Property Code; or
(2)to which the case is assigned.
(b)An authority may file the declaration of taking concurrently with or subsequent to the filing of the condemnation petition but may not file the declaration after the special commissioners have made an award in the condemnation proceeding.
(c)An authority may not file a declaration of taking before the completion of all:
(1)environmental documentation, including a final environmental impact statement or a record of decision, that is required by federal or state law;
